About the Cebu – Tubigon crossing
Two operators, FastCat and Lite Ferries, together provide 12 daily sailings between Cebu and Tubigon, a crossing of around 30 nautical miles. This domestic route in the Philippines operates every day of the week. The first ferry of the day departs at 01:00 and the last leaves at 22:00, with a scheduled crossing time of two hours for all sailings. Fares start from ₱396, though the final price can change based on the season and vehicle type.

The route connects Cebu City with the port of Tubigon on the island of Bohol. From Cebu, other direct ferry services connect to destinations including Cagayan de Oro, Dapitan, and Dumaguete. Tubigon's ferry connections are primarily with Cebu City and its metropolitan area ports like Ouano and Talisay.
